Minnesota State Highway 107 (MN 107) is a 17.571-mile-long (28.278 km) highway in east-central Minnesota, which runs from its intersection with State Highway 65 in Stanchfield Township near Braham and continues north to its northern terminus at its intersection with State Highway 23 in Pine County near Brook Park.
Pine County is a county in the U.S. state of Minnesota.As of the 2020 census, the population was 28,876. [2] Its county seat is Pine City. [3] The county was formed in 1856 and organized in 1872.
